Peel, core, and slice the Granny Smith apples into 1/4-inch thick wedges.
In a large skillet, melt the unsalted butter over medium heat.
Add the sliced apples to the skillet and stir to coat them evenly in the melted butter.
Sprinkle the brown sugar, ground cinnamon, and a pinch of salt evenly over the apples.
Drizzle the lemon juice and vanilla extract over the apples and cook for 5 minutes, stirring occasionally.
Add 2 tablespoons of water to the skillet. Cover the skillet with a lid and reduce the heat to medium-low.
Cook the apples for an additional 12-15 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the apples are soft and caramelized but still hold their shape.
Remove the skillet from heat and let the fried apples sit for 2 minutes to allow the sauce to thicken slightly.
Serve warm as a side dish or dessert, optionally topped with whipped cream or vanilla ice cream.
